Output 73f3d773681b6db4135c08b2a7ba352938da41ba34c03edeccd01cacbce05410:250

value
566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ea645a8cb651a357386fd9915d08379a402106bf42fc54a7b2f7c5d07905e5e2
address
bc1pafj94r9k2x34wwr0mxg46zphnfqzzp4lgt79ffaj7lzaq7g9uh3q4ytspm
transaction
73f3d773681b6db4135c08b2a7ba352938da41ba34c03edeccd01cacbce05410
spent
true